I have the 19" wheels. Yes they can and should be rotated just like any car with 4 wheels and tires of the same size. If you don't care how long the set of tires last then don't rotate. I've rotated twice and went through the relearning process just like the manual directs. No problems.

If you are replacing a wheel you might have to buy the stem since it normally breaks when you take it off. 2012 stem is different since it has the metal in the middle where you screw in the tpms.

I just replaced the rims on my SS. New TPMS in them. Made sure old tires were down in my storage shed, went into the DIC menu for the TMPS hit the reset button, (yes on the DIC, it did display hold tool near front tire) (but let air out of tire) horn sounded, started left front driver side, let out air till horn beeped, moved to rear pass side, next, next..After all were done, horn sounded again twice...it was that easy. I do have a later 2011. Tools are not needed. Does it make sense that you need a tool to reset them? No, that means anyone who works on the tires or ability too, would have to send to GM shop to reset TPMS.
